Just got myself a 1997 3.2tl with only 61,000k !! on it.
the check engine light is on. Got it scanned by a garage and here are the results..
p1300
p1304
p1305
p1306
p1399 (pending)
Seems to be something to do with ignition system and misfiring.
But I don't know where to start looking.
Any suggettions?

The codes 1300-1306 are codes for misfire. P1300 is random misfire, and other are specific cylinder misfire codes. Bad spark plugs seems first place to go.
P1399 is not defined as a code in manual I have. It may help to reset the ECU, drive and see what codes come back immediately.
I assume engine is indeed missing?
good luck

Finally got it fixed,
Plugs,coils,compression, injectors alternator,erg and fuel filter all checked okay
It came down to replacing the misfire detection module.
I was quoted over $500 for one.
Got one for $50 at the auto wreckers.
Reset the codes and no more Check engine light.
